Public Vendue for Estate of Rouexy Suara at Gettysburg

Administrator of the Rouexy Suara estate announces a public sale on March 7 1860 at the premises in Gettysburg Adams county. Included are multiple lots of ground with dwelling houses and improvements a railroad stock and turnpike shares also a corner business lot with extensive grounds and several smaller town lots plus four building lots. Terms are to be announced at sale by administrator G McCruary. Also advertised is a merchant offer from Jacobs and Brother tailoring goods ready made clothing and fabrics in Chambersburg street with prices and assurances.

A Curious Prayer Amid Millerism Reports

A Western Christian Advocate correspondent relays a Texas tale of a Campbellite preacher accused of unauthorized preaching and moral impropriety. The account recalls a dubious prayer condemning the preacher, linking him to gambling in Galveston and theft of a horse, before he reappears in Cincinnati Millerite tents.

Our poor Barnitxa in Winter Dr. Smith bathes daily in open water

The Newburyport Herald notes Dr M G Smith of Newburyport has practiced plunging into freezing water for years and continues this winter. He claims the bath is delightful even at twelve to fifteen degrees below zero and reports strong health with brief exposure after fast movement. He warns of cold fingers but says dipping back restores them quickly.

Skeleton of Bentham on display in Dr Smiths parlor

A late European letter describes Doctor Southwood Smith hosting a private viewing where the skeleton of Jeremy Bentham is dressed to resemble his portrait and used as an assistant during study and entertainment. Louis Napoleon is also described on a Paris avenue, driving horses with a calm, youthful look. Further items include reports of earthquakes in Japan and a dramatic political speech praising union and condemning treason.
